

Compact museum in downtown Wallace preserving Silver Valley mining history — corrugated metal tools, vintage signage, reconstructed mine shaft and period storefronts. Photograph gritty textures, small-scale industrial artifacts and the museum's wood-and-brick streetscape. Best light: golden hour for warm exteriors, overcast for even interior detail. Small site with street parking on Bank St; wheelchair access limited in some exhibits. Pay admission; weekdays and mornings are quieter.
